The City Hall of University City, Missouri, the seat of municipal government for University City, Missouri, was built in 1903 as the Woman's Magazine Building, the headquarters of a magazine publishing company, and became a city hall in 1930.     April 12, 1982. The Sutter-Meyer House is the oldest known residence in University City, Missouri, United States. It was built in 1873 and was added to the National Register of Historic Places in 1982. In 1986, it was designated a Landmark of University City by the Historic Preservation Commission.
